Front end has changed completely, tech has been improved. biggest changes are how it's built less pieces far more efficient way of building the car, apparently making it cheaper to build and more streamlined

Matt Watson and Robert Lewellyn have done reviews of the facelifted cars, still might not be to everyone's taste, but is on another level in terms of tech and quality.

SR now gets 346 miles of range out of a 60kwh lfp battery
LR dual motor is now 423 miles, also with the same battery original lr) very impressive figures and according to Matt Watson no price rises.
